Aix-les-Bains

Aix-les-Bains, nestled in the heart of the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region of France, is a hidden gem that offers a perfect blend of natural beauty, rich history, and vibrant culture. This charming town, located on the shores of the stunning Lac du Bourget, is renowned for its thermal spas, making it an ideal destination for relaxation and rejuvenation. Visitors can indulge in the therapeutic waters of the town’s famous thermal baths, which have been attracting wellness seekers for centuries.

For those who love the outdoors, Aix-les-Bains is a paradise. The surrounding mountains and lakes provide endless opportunities for hiking, biking, and water sports. A leisurely stroll along the picturesque lakefront promenade offers breathtaking views and a chance to soak in the serene atmosphere. The town is also home to the beautiful Parc de Verdure, where visitors can enjoy a peaceful picnic or attend one of the many cultural events held throughout the year.

History enthusiasts will be captivated by the town’s rich heritage. The ancient Roman ruins, including the impressive Temple of Diana, offer a glimpse into the past, while the elegant Belle Époque architecture reflects the town’s glamorous history as a popular resort destination. The Faure Museum, housed in a charming 19th-century villa, showcases an impressive collection of art, including works by Rodin and Degas.

Food lovers will delight in the local cuisine, which features fresh, seasonal ingredients and traditional Savoyard dishes. The town’s bustling markets are a great place to sample regional specialties and pick up unique souvenirs.

Whether you’re seeking adventure, relaxation, or a bit of both, Aix-les-Bains has something for everyone. Its unique blend of natural beauty, cultural richness, and historical charm make it a must-visit destination in the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region.

FAQs
What is the best time to visit Aix-les-Bains?
The best time to visit Aix-les-Bains is during the summer months from June to September when the weather is warm and ideal for outdoor activities. However, spring (April to June) and autumn (September to October) also offer pleasant weather and fewer tourists.
How do I get to Aix-les-Bains?
Aix-les-Bains is accessible by train, car, and plane. The nearest major airport is Geneva Airport, about an hour's drive away. You can also take a train from major French cities like Paris, Lyon, and Marseille to Aix-les-Bains-Le Revard station.
What are the must-see attractions in Aix-les-Bains?
Must-see attractions include Lac du Bourget, the largest natural lake in France, the Thermes Chevalley for thermal baths, the Faure Museum, and the Abbaye d'Hautecombe. Don't miss a stroll along the Esplanade du Lac and a visit to the Casino Grand Cercle.
Are there any outdoor activities to enjoy in Aix-les-Bains?
Yes, Aix-les-Bains offers a variety of outdoor activities such as boating, swimming, and fishing on Lac du Bourget, hiking in the surrounding mountains, and cycling along scenic routes. The area is also popular for paragliding and golf.
What local dishes should I try in Aix-les-Bains?
You should try local dishes such as fondue savoyarde, tartiflette, and diots (Savoy sausages). For dessert, don't miss the gâteau de Savoie and the delicious local cheeses like Reblochon and Tomme de Savoie.

Are there any cultural events or festivals in Aix-les-Bains?
Yes, Aix-les-Bains hosts several cultural events and festivals throughout the year, including the Musilac music festival in July, the Festival des Nuits Romantiques in September, and various local markets and fairs. Check the local event calendar for specific dates and details.
